Fix problem with maildir delivery into a folder that is excluded from
quota calculations.

+ /* Check to see if we are delivering into an ignored directory, that is,
+ if the delivery path starts with the quota check path, and the rest
+ of the deliver path matches the regex; if so, set a flag to disable quota
+ checking and maildirsize updating. */
+
+ if (Ustrncmp(path, check_path, check_path_len) == 0)
{
- DEBUG(D_transport)
- debug_printf("using regex for maildir directory selection: %s\n",
- ob->maildir_dir_regex);
+ uschar *s = path + check_path_len;
+ while (*s == '/') s++;
+ s = (*s == 0)? US "new" : string_sprintf("%s/new", s);
+ if (pcre_exec(dir_regex, NULL, CS s, Ustrlen(s), 0, 0, NULL, 0) < 0)
+ {
+ disable_quota = TRUE;
+ DEBUG(D_transport) debug_printf("delivery directory does not match "
+ "maildir_quota_directory_regex: disabling quota\n");
+ }
}
